That morning started quietly in Jerusalem on the first Easter. The disciples of Jesus of Nazareth had been grieving through the Sabbath, now it was the morning after, and some of the women among them started out early to finish the preparation of the body that they hadn’t been able to complete before burying their friend. For the followers of Jesus this entire week has been a wild ride. From the triumphal entry to the crucifixion they have careened wildly from one emotional extreme to another. Now, feeling that all is finished, they go to do their final service for the one they thought would be their messiah.
